Working on a 41-RP2 with bad rubber in the tone arm pivot assembly -- as in no rubber left at all, it's completely disintegrated to powder. I'm trying to figure out the best way to replace the rubber, but I don't know for sure how it's supposed to fit together, or how thick the rubber itself should be. Does anyone have one of these with original rubber intact, who could give me a quick description of how it should go together?
